the Red Square

The first and main one of them is, without a doubt, the Red Square. This is what springs to anybody’s mind when they hear Moscow or even Russia. This is the symbol of political and cultural power of the country, and besides, it is just a very nice place to look at.

On one side of it, you have St. Basil’s Cathedral, which is a famous and iconic structure on its own. On the other one, there sits the Historical Museum.

If you are a history aficionado, our recommendation is to visit it, but be careful – it’s easy to lose track of time while admiring the exhibitions.

the Kremlin

The main attraction on the Red Square, though, is the Kremlin. Realistically, it can take a few days to properly visit and explore, but since we don’t have this much time, we will have to compromise. But worry not – we have just a few pieces of advice you can follow.

The most unusual sights to see within the Kremlin are the Tsar Cannon and the Tsar Bell. These enormous items provide an excellent opportunity for taking pictures.

While in the Kremlin, also be sure to visit the Armory that contains plenty of rare and interesting historical items.

Panorama360

Leaving the heart of Moscow, let us travel to the best viewing platform in the city, Panorama360. Located at the top of the Federation Tower, it allows for truly magnificent photos and views. Almost the entire city can be observed from this point.

Additionally, you can visit the ice cream museum that is situated right there or opt for a more substantial dinner in one of the numerous restaurants in the vicinity of the tower.

The Cathedral Mosque

To all Muslims as well as people interested in Islam we recommend visiting the Cathedral Mosque. Being one of the tallest mosques in Europe, it is a very fascinating sight to behold. Be sure to enter it, as its interior rivals the exterior in beauty.

the Mosfilm Museum

If you like cinema, the Mosfilm Museum is for you. Here, you will see many props and sets used in famous Soviet movies and just get insight into the inner workings of the movie industry in general.
